This 40 centavos commemorative stamp from Mexico, issued in 1974, honors Manuel María Ponce (1882–1948), one of the most influential Mexican composers and pianists of the early 20th century. The design, based on a portrait by Miguel del Pino, depicts Ponce at the piano, highlighting his dedication to music and his role in shaping modern Mexican classical composition. Printed by T.I.E.V., the stamp marks the 26th anniversary of his death and the centenary of his enduring musical legacy. The elegant gold frame and soft tones convey reverence for his artistic achievements.
